Is Sistani Really Smacking Down Sadr or What?
Honestly I've no idea. AJ Strata e-mails with commentary and a link to this post from Bill Roggio.
The glass half full view emphasizes that we have a statement from Muqtada al Sadr that he'd disband the Mahdi Army if Grand Ayatollah Ali Sistani order it. Then a statement from Sistani that Maliki was in the right demanding Mahdi members to turn in their weapons. Sounds like a check mate on Sadrist power, right?
The glass half empty view: Sistani is leaving it up to al Sadr to disband the Mahdi Army himself.
After five years of dealing with these douchebags you can call me a pessimist if you want, but let's just say I'm skeptical that the Shia militia problem is going to go away any time soon.
